文档

解压

提取tar文件的内容

描述

例子

将(解压tarfilename的存档内容tarfilename保存每个文件的属性和时间戳。解压可以从本地系统或Internet URL提取文件。

如果存在同名的文件且该文件不是只读的,MATLAB®覆盖它。在微软®窗户®平台,MATLAB不设置隐藏,系统,和存档属性。

例子

将(解压tarfilenameoutputfolder的存档内容tarfilenameoutputfolder.如果outputfolder不存在,MATLAB创建它。

例子

文件名=压缩(___返回包含提取文件名称的字符向量单元格数组。您可以将此语法与前面语法中的任何输入参数组合一起使用。

例子

全部折叠

创建一个tar文件,然后将其解压缩到文件夹中备份

为当前文件夹中的所有程序文件创建一个tar文件。

焦油(“myfiles.tar.gz”,{“* m”‘* .mlx‘});

提取myfiles.tar.gz的文件夹备份

programFiles =压缩(“myfile”“备份”
programFiles =1 x3单元阵列{'备份/ myfile1。m}{“备份/ myfile2。m '}{}“备份/ ExtractT……”

下载归档文件并从URL解压缩到本地文件夹。

假设您有存档文件example.tar.gz存储在URL中http://example.com/example.tar.gz.下载该文件并将其解压缩到例子文件夹中。

url =“http://example.com/example.tar.gz”;gunzip (url,“例子”);将(解压的例子/ example.tar“例子”);

输入参数

全部折叠

要从中提取的tar文件的名称,指定为字符向量或字符串标量。如果tarfilename没有扩展,MATLAB搜索tarfilename附加的. tgzgz,或. tar.如果指定. tgz. gz扩展,然后解压提取指定的文件gunzip

您可以指定tarfilename作为绝对路径,或相对于当前文件夹的路径。

如果tarfilename是一个URL,那么tarfilename必须包括协议类型(例如,http://).MATLAB将URL下载到系统上的临时文件夹中,然后在清理时将URL删除。

数据类型:字符|字符串

提取文件的目标文件夹,指定为字符向量或字符串标量。

数据类型:字符|字符串

之前介绍过的R2006a